On August 29, 2026, President Salvador Illa of Catalonia convened his regional government ministers for a two-day off-site meeting styled as a 'team-building' initiative, similar to corporate team-building exercises. The event included shared meals, walks, and meetings but avoided typical games like zip lines. This marks the fifth time the Catalan government has held such gatherings, with accumulated costs reaching 211,757.32 euros. The Popular Party (PP) criticized the expense during the summer.
